Water auditing is a method of quantifying water flows and quality in simple or complex systems, with a view to reducing water usage and often saving money on otherwise unnecessary water use. A water quality standard defines the water quality goals of a water body or portion thereof, in part, by designating the use or uses to be made of the water.
